    Whole home generator

    Anybody have experience with a 20 kw with Briggs & Stratton engine. That or the Generac seems to be the ones most folks use. I’ve been thinking about getting one for several years but I’m ready to pull the trigger now. Appreciate any input from owners.

              We have a 22kv generac and it was installed when we had the house built. Living in a rural area with trees/power lines the best money we spent imo. At the time it cost us &6500.00 with the transfer switch installed.

                I have a GE 20kw powered by a Vanguard engine and automatic transfer switch. It runs on propane. I have had it for 7 years with no issues.

                It has currently been running for 29 hours straight. It has run for 3-4 days straight several times. I am located in SW Rusk county.

                      I think the Generac is the way to go but make sure you vet the contractor doing the install. My sister had one installed in January 2018 after dealing with Harvey and it ran for about 2 hours and then never again when it was needed. They sat through Laura for a week and Zeta for 3-4 days. It was finally repaired in November 2020 and now working correctly.

                      Generac customer service was useless. They kept sending techs out, inspect, order parts and then never show up again. It was all in the fuel line and each new tech blamed the last tech for doing something wrong.

                      They also lost 3 full 500 gallon tanks over the course of that time due to it leaking out at the generator.

                      Do your homework on who makes the installation.

                        Yes on a generac for the warranty to be good it has to be a generac licensed technician. Under the warranty it’s suppose to be serviced by them also once a year. I purchased a 10 year warranty for 1000.00 plus the original cost of 6500.00 I forgot to add. No problem with ours yet after 4 years.
